About Agyn
Agyn is an innovative open-source management layer designed specifically for AI agents. It enables organizations to run AI agents safely and efficiently across teams, moving them off individual employee laptops and into a secure, centralized environment. This transition is crucial when AI begins to interact with production data, as it introduces the need for enhanced security measures, budget controls, and IT governance. With Agyn, each AI agent operates in an isolated sandbox, ensuring that sensitive information remains protected. Teams can benefit from role-based access, budget caps, and comprehensive audit trails, making it an ideal solution for companies transitioning from experimental AI projects to full-scale production. Agyn supports multiple AI models, including Claude, Codex, and custom-built solutions, and can be deployed in self-hosted environments or via the cloud. This flexibility empowers non-technical teams to utilize AI agents while maintaining oversight from engineering, finance, and IT departments.
Features of Agyn
Multi-env Deployment
Agyn facilitates rapid deployment of AI agents into various environments or private networks, including internal services accessed through VPNs and VPCs. This feature allows organizations to reach services securely and efficiently, ensuring agents can perform optimally without compromising security protocols.
Least Privilege Security
Every agent operates under a least privilege model, meaning they only have access to the resources necessary for their functions. Agyn implements static policies and a policy agent to inspect tool calls, ensuring that secrets remain hidden from the AI model, thereby defending against potential prompt injection and sensitive data leaks.
Per-Agent Tracking
Agyn offers robust tracking for each agent, allowing organizations to set budget limits, receive usage alerts, and attribute costs accurately. This feature aids in maintaining financial oversight, enabling teams to monitor spending across different agents and workflows to keep AI costs manageable.
Team Sharing and Access Control
With Agyn, organizations can easily manage access across teams through role-based permissions. This feature ensures that the right employees have access to the appropriate agents, facilitating safe sharing while maintaining governance as AI adoption grows within the company.
